What is a Degree?

A degree is an academic qualification awarded by a college or university upon completion of a program of study. Degrees are typically divided into undergraduate and graduate levels, with undergraduate degrees being the most common. Undergraduate degrees are typically awarded after a student has completed a four-year program of study, while graduate degrees are awarded after a student has completed a two-year program of study. Degrees are typically awarded in a variety of fields, including business, engineering, science, and the humanities.

Steps to Obtaining a Degree

The process of obtaining a degree can vary depending on the type of degree and the institution offering the degree. Generally, however, the process involves the following steps:

1. Research: Researching the various degree programs available is the first step in the process. Students should consider the type of degree they are interested in, the cost of the program, and the length of the program.

2. Application: Once a student has identified a program of interest, they must complete an application. This typically involves submitting transcripts, letters of recommendation, and other documents.

3. Acceptance: After the application is submitted, the student will receive a letter of acceptance or rejection from the institution. If accepted, the student will be required to pay tuition and other fees.

4. Coursework: Once accepted, the student will begin taking courses in their chosen field of study. Depending on the program, this may involve attending classes on campus or completing coursework online.

5. Completion: After completing all of the required coursework, the student will be required to take a final exam or complete a final project. Upon successful completion of the program, the student will receive their degree.
